Transaction 32d2837f122808d9edc83383fe0363340a308442773e87141e574e5b4df72e71
1 Input
2 Outputs
- 32d2837f122808d9edc83383fe0363340a308442773e87141e574e5b4df72e71:0
- 32d2837f122808d9edc83383fe0363340a308442773e87141e574e5b4df72e71:1
value 1071810
address 1KTkKSx5DYwNyz6CvLJf1ZxVbiqexqUhJd
value 75799472
address 1KBDtLbRip3dqhzT6LeDLPc8ssJUxA1Kwi